The surface area of a cube is given by the formula:
SA = 6s^2
where SA is the surface area and s is the length of one side.
In this case, we know that the surface area is 96 square meters, so we can set up an equation:
96 = 6s^2
Solving for s, we get:
s^2 = 16
s = 4
So the length of one side of the cube is 4 meters.
The volume of a cube is given by the formula:
V = s^3
where V is the volume and s is the length of one side.
Plugging in s = 4, we get:
V = 4^3 = 64 cubic meters
So the volume of the cube is 64 cubic meters.
